1. Contouring: The Holy Grail of Sculpting

When it comes to sculpting your face, contouring is the ultimate game-changer. This technique involves using a matte bronzer or a contouring powder that’s a shade or two darker than your natural skin tone. With a soft brush, carefully apply the contouring product on the hollows of your cheeks, temples, jawline, and sides of your nose. Blend well using circular motions to create the illusion of shadows, adding depth and prominence to your facial features.

2. Highlighting: Creating Dimension

Highlighting is the perfect companion to contouring, as it helps enhance the areas you want to bring forward. Choose a highlighter that complements your skin tone and has a subtle shimmer. Apply it to the high points of your face, such as the tops of your cheekbones, bridge of your nose, cupid’s bow, and brow bone. The light-reflecting particles will instantly create an illusion of lifted and sculpted features.

4. Proper Contouring Products and Tools

When it comes to contouring, using the right products and tools is key. Opt for a contouring powder or cream that is specifically formulated for your skin type. For beginners, powder-based products are generally easier to work with. As for tools, invest in a good quality contour brush or a blending sponge to ensure seamless application and blending. Remember, the right products and tools can make a world of difference in achieving a flawless sculpted look.

5. Blending: The Secret to Natural Results

One of the most important aspects of achieving a sculpted face is blending. Blending your contour and highlight products well ensures a natural-looking finish. Use a clean brush or sponge to gradually blend the products into your skin. Avoid any harsh lines or visible edges. Remember, subtlety is key when it comes to contouring, so take your time and blend, blend, blend!
